The Calexico Bulldogs will head out on the road to face off against the Mater Dei Catholic Crusaders at 2:00 p.m. on Friday. Calexico will be strutting in after a win while Mater Dei Catholic will be coming in after a loss.
On Thursday, Calexico needed a bit of extra time to put away Clairemont. They came out on top in a nail-biter against the Chieftains, sneaking past 5-4. The victory was nothing new for the Bulldogs as they're now sitting on three straight.
Meanwhile, Mater Dei Catholic didn't have quite enough to beat Westview on Thursday and fell 8-7.
Jean Pierre Noury made the most of his time at bat despite the final result and scored two runs while going 2-for-4. Gianni Castellanos also deserves some recognition as he got his first hits of the season.
Calexico's win bumped their record up to 12-3-1. As for Mater Dei Catholic, their defeat dropped their record down to 4-10.
Calexico beat Mater Dei Catholic 8-3 in their previous meeting back in March of 2024. Will the Bulldogs repeat their success, or do the Crusaders have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
